Tabulaephorus punctinervis is a moth of the family Pterophoridae.
It is found on the Iberian Peninsula and in France, Italy, as well as on Sardinia, Corsica, Sicily, Cyprus and the Canary Islands.
[2] The wingspan is 16–19 mm.
[3] The larvae feed on Carlina corymbosa.
